If you love the cozy flavors of the holidays but want something classic and comforting in a glass, you are absolutely going to adore this Creamy Eggnog with Nutmeg and Cinnamon Recipe. It’s a luscious blend of rich egg yolks, warming spices, and silky cream that brings together all the nostalgic feels in every sip. Whether you’re looking to impress guests or simply treat yourself to a festive indulgence, this recipe strikes the perfect balance between smoothness and spice, making it a timeless favorite year after year.

Ingredients You’ll Need
Gathering simple ingredients that are easy to find makes this Creamy Eggnog with Nutmeg and Cinnamon Recipe so approachable. Each ingredient plays a special role, from the velvety texture of heavy cream to the aromatic punch of nutmeg and cinnamon that truly defines its character.
- 6 large egg yolks: The heart of the eggnog, providing richness and a creamy base.
- 1/2 cup granulated sugar: Adds just the right touch of sweetness to balance the spices.
- 1 cup heavy whipping cream: Delivers that luxurious, thick texture eggs alone can’t achieve.
- 2 cups milk: Lightens the mixture while keeping it smooth and drinkable.
- 1/2 tsp ground nutmeg: Brings warm, slightly sweet spice that’s signature to eggnog.
- 1/4 tsp ground cinnamon: Adds depth and warmth, complementing the nutmeg perfectly.
- Pinch of salt: Enhances all the flavors without overpowering.
- 1/2 tsp vanilla extract: Rounds out the flavor with sweet, fragrant notes.
- Ground cinnamon for topping: A final dusting that makes every sip look and taste festive.
- Optional alcohol: If you’d like, a splash of bourbon, rum, or brandy gives it that classic adult twist.
How to Make Creamy Eggnog with Nutmeg and Cinnamon Recipe
Step 1: Heat the Cream and Spices
Start by combining the milk, heavy cream, nutmeg, and cinnamon in a medium saucepan over medium-low heat. Whisk frequently as you heat the mixture just until it’s nearly boiling. This slow warming helps draw out the warmth of the spices while keeping the cream silky and smooth. Be patient here; you want it hot but not scorching.
Step 2: Whisk the Egg Yolks and Sugar
While your cream mixture warms up, whisk the egg yolks and sugar together in a large bowl until the sugar has dissolved a bit and everything looks pale and creamy. Add the sugar gradually, a couple of tablespoons at a time, whisking thoroughly as you go to ensure it dissolves completely and creates that silky base that makes this recipe so irresistible.
Step 3: Temper the Eggs with Hot Cream
This part is key to prevent scrambled eggs. Slowly ladle about 1/2 cup of your hot cream mixture into the egg yolks, whisking continuously to gently raise the temperature of the eggs. Repeat this process with more hot cream until you’ve combined roughly three-quarters of the creamy mixture into the yolks.
Step 4: Cook to Perfection
Pour your enriched egg mixture back into the saucepan and cook it over medium heat. Keep whisking constantly, paying close attention to the edges to avoid any curdling. Use a spoon to stir the edges to keep the mixture smooth. You’re looking for it to thicken slightly and reach 160 degrees Fahrenheit — this temperature ensures it’s safe to drink while still ultra creamy.
Step 5: Add the Vanilla and Cool
Remove the saucepan from heat and whisk in the vanilla extract. You’ll notice the mixture has thickened just a bit, but don’t worry — it will continue to thicken as it cools, becoming irresistibly luscious.
Step 6: Serve and Garnish
Pour your eggnog into glasses and finish each one with a light dusting of ground cinnamon. This small touch adds a beautiful burst of aroma and visual appeal. If you prefer, add a splash of your favorite alcohol here for a warming adult treat.
How to Serve Creamy Eggnog with Nutmeg and Cinnamon Recipe

Garnishes
A simple sprinkle of ground cinnamon is classic, but you can also get creative by adding a cinnamon stick as a stirrer or a twist of orange peel to brighten the deep spice flavors. A dollop of whipped cream makes it extra festive and indulgent.
Side Dishes
Creamy Eggnog with Nutmeg and Cinnamon Recipe pairs beautifully with holiday cookies like gingerbread or sugar cookies, hearty spiced cakes, or even savory bites like roasted nuts. The creamy sweetness is a perfect contrast to crunchy, spicy, or salty accompaniments.
Creative Ways to Present
Serve your eggnog in clear glass mugs or vintage-style mugs to showcase its creamy texture. Rim the glass with cinnamon sugar for a festive touch, or float a tiny cinnamon stick or star anise on top to impress your guests with a cozy, elegant look.
Make Ahead and Storage
Storing Leftovers
If you have leftover eggnog, store it in an airtight container in the refrigerator. Because it contains eggs and dairy, it’s best consumed within 2 to 3 days for optimal freshness and safety.
Freezing
While freezing the eggnog isn’t recommended due to changes in texture once thawed, you can freeze the custard base before adding the cream and spices. Thaw it in the fridge overnight and then finish with cream and spices to maintain the best flavor and consistency.
Reheating
To reheat, warm the eggnog gently on the stove over low heat, stirring often to prevent curdling. Avoid boiling to keep the texture silky. If you prefer it chilled, simply stir well before serving again cold or over ice.
FAQs
Can I make this recipe without alcohol?
Absolutely! This Creamy Eggnog with Nutmeg and Cinnamon Recipe is fantastic enjoyed alcohol-free. The warm spices and rich base are more than enough to satisfy your festive cravings without any need for spirits.
Is this recipe safe to consume since it uses raw eggs?
This recipe cooks the egg yolks to 160 degrees Fahrenheit, which is the recommended temperature to kill harmful bacteria, making it safe to enjoy. Just be sure to follow the heating instructions carefully.
Can I use a different type of milk?
Yes! Whole milk works beautifully, but you can substitute skim or even a plant-based milk like almond or oat milk to lighten the recipe or accommodate dietary needs, though the texture will be less rich.
How long will homemade eggnog keep in the fridge?
Stored properly in a sealed container, your eggnog will last 2 to 3 days refrigerated. Make sure to give it a good stir before serving to recombine any separation.
Can I make this recipe vegan?
The traditional Creamy Eggnog with Nutmeg and Cinnamon Recipe relies heavily on eggs and dairy for its classic texture and flavor. However, vegan variations exist using coconut milk, cashew cream, and egg substitutes, but they will deliver a different flavor experience.
Final Thoughts
There is something truly magical about sipping on a glass of Creamy Eggnog with Nutmeg and Cinnamon Recipe—it evokes warmth, comfort, and a festive spirit all at once. Whether you make it for holiday celebrations or a quiet evening at home, this recipe is guaranteed to become a treasured favorite in your kitchen. So go ahead, make a batch and let those inviting aromas fill your home as you enjoy every satisfying sip!
Print
Creamy Eggnog with Nutmeg and Cinnamon Recipe
- Prep Time: 5 minutes
- Cook Time: 10 minutes
- Total Time: 15 minutes
- Yield: 4 to 4.4 glasses (approximately 4 servings)
- Category: Beverage
- Method: Stovetop
- Cuisine: American
Description
A classic, creamy, and rich homemade eggnog recipe perfect for holiday gatherings. This comforting beverage blends eggs, sugar, cream, milk, and warm spices, gently cooked to a safe temperature and optionally spiked with your choice of alcohol.
Ingredients
Eggnog Base
- 6 large egg yolks
- 1/2 cup granulated sugar
- 1 cup heavy whipping cream
- 2 cups milk
- 1/2 tsp ground nutmeg
- 1/4 tsp ground cinnamon
- Pinch of salt
- 1/2 tsp vanilla extract
Toppings and Optional
- Ground cinnamon for dusting
- Alcohol (optional; such as bourbon, rum, or brandy)
Instructions
- Heat the Dairy and Spices: In a medium saucepan over medium-low heat, combine the milk, heavy cream, ground nutmeg, and ground cinnamon. Whisk frequently and gently heat the mixture until it almost reaches boiling, ensuring it doesn’t scorch or boil over.
- Whisk Egg Yolks and Sugar: In a large bowl, vigorously whisk together the egg yolks and granulated sugar. Add the sugar gradually in a couple of tablespoon increments, whisking thoroughly after each addition to create a smooth, pale mixture.
- Temper the Eggs: Using a ladle, slowly add about 1/2 cup of the hot cream mixture to the egg yolk mixture while whisking constantly. Gradually add the rest of the hot cream in increments, thoroughly whisking after each addition. When about three-quarters of the cream has been incorporated, pour the combined mixture back into the saucepan.
- Cook to Safe Temperature: Heat the mixture on medium, stirring constantly with a whisk and occasionally scraping the edges with a spoon to prevent curdling. Cook until the mixture reaches 160°F (71°C), gently thickening to a custard-like consistency.
- Add Flavor and Cool: Remove the saucepan from heat and whisk in the vanilla extract. The eggnog will be slightly thickened now and will continue to thicken as it cools.
- Serve and Garnish: Pour the eggnog into glasses, lightly dust the tops with ground cinnamon, and add alcohol if desired. Serve chilled or slightly warmed according to preference.
Notes
- For safety, be sure to cook the egg mixture to 160°F to kill any harmful bacteria.
- Alcohol (bourbon, rum, or brandy) can be added to taste after cooking and cooling.
- Eggnog can be refrigerated for up to 2 days; stir well before serving.
- For a non-alcoholic version, simply omit the alcohol.
- Use fresh, high-quality eggs for the best flavor and safety.

